Watch The Killers Perform ‘Blowback’ on ‘Colbert’

The Killers celebrated the release of their new album, Imploding the Mirage, with a performance of the track ‘Blowback’ on The Late Show with Stephen Colbert. Check it out below.

Originally scheduled for release back in May, Imploding the Mirage arrived this Friday (August 20) via Island. Following 2017’s Wonderful Wonderful, the record was co-produced by Shawn Everett and Foxygen’s Jonathan Rado and recorded in Los Angeles, Las Vegas, and Park City, Utah. It features guest appearances from the likes of Lindsey Buckingham, Weyes Blood, The War On Drugs’ Adam Granduciel, Blake Mills, and more.

Previously, the band performed early singles from the album in their own bathroom and recording studio, but on their latest performance, they played on an actual concert stage – albeit without an audience.
